We've noticed that some of you are experiencing high latency and poor performance during cross-server matches in the Arena. To address this, we will be optimizing our matchmaking rules this week. Here are the details:
The system will now prioritize matching you with other players from your own server within the same Battlegroup. This is intended to reduce latency and improve match stability. If a suitable opponent isn't found on your server, the search will then expand to other servers within your Battlegroup.
For example: HK/Macau/Taiwan server players will be matched with HK/Macau/Taiwan players first; US East with US East; US West with US West.
If your physical location is different from your selected Battlegroup's region (e.g., an Asian player choosing a US Battlegroup) and you are matched with a US player, the match will be hosted on the US player's server.
